Petrobras Secures 20-Year LNG Supply Deal with Sempra Infrastructure

Sempra Infrastructure has secured a significant long-term buyer for its U.S. liquefied natural gas (LNG) portfolio, signing a 20-year sales and purchase agreement with Petrobras.

The deal gives Petrobras access to approximately 800,000 tonnes per year of LNG from Sempra's Port Arthur LNG Phase 2 project in Texas.

This marks the first South American company in Sempra Infrastructure's LNG customer portfolio and adds another major international buyer to its Port Arthur development.

Port Arthur Phase 2 is a significant expansion project that will add roughly 13 million tonnes per annum of liquefaction capacity through two additional trains, bringing total production capacity to around 26 million tonnes per year once both phases are operational.
